Understanding R-Values and Insulation Requirements

The effectiveness of insulation is measured in R-values, which indicate resistance to heat flow. Higher R-values mean better insulating power, and homes in Amherst require specific R-values to meet both comfort standards and energy codes. Current recommendations for New Hampshire homes suggest attic insulation R-values between R-49 and R-60, depending on your heating system type and home construction. Many older homes in the area have R-values as low as R-19, representing a significant opportunity for energy savings and comfort improvement.

We examine not just the amount of insulation present but also its condition, as insulation can settle, compress, or deteriorate over time. Moisture damage, pest infestations, and simple aging can all compromise insulation effectiveness, reducing its R-value significantly below its original specifications. Types of Attic Insulation Available

Modern attic insulation options extend far beyond traditional pink fiberglass batts, and we install various types depending on your home’s specific requirements and budget considerations. Blown-in cellulose insulation, made from recycled paper products treated with fire retardants, provides excellent coverage in irregular spaces and around obstacles like wiring and plumbing. This material offers an R-value of approximately 3.5 per inch and excels at filling gaps that might otherwise allow air infiltration.

Fiberglass insulation comes in both batt and blown-in forms, with blown-in fiberglass offering similar benefits to cellulose in terms of coverage completeness. Spray foam insulation, while typically more expensive initially, provides both insulation and air sealing in one application, achieving R-values of up to 6.5 per inch for closed-cell varieties. The Installation Process and Quality Standards

Professional attic insulation installation involves multiple critical steps that ensure optimal performance and longevity. We begin by addressing air sealing opportunities, as even the best insulation cannot compensate for significant air leaks. Common leak points include gaps around chimney penetrations, plumbing vents, electrical boxes, and attic access hatches. Our technicians meticulously seal these areas using appropriate materials like caulk, expanding foam, or specialized gaskets before adding insulation.

Proper ventilation maintenance remains crucial during insulation upgrades. Soffit vents must remain unobstructed to allow fresh air intake, while ridge or gable vents facilitate hot air exhaust. We install ventilation baffles where necessary to maintain clear airflow channels from soffits to upper ventilation points. This balanced ventilation system prevents moisture accumulation that could lead to mold growth, wood rot, or premature shingle deterioration. Energy Savings and Return on Investment

Upgrading attic insulation typically ranks among the most cost-effective home improvements in terms of energy savings and comfort enhancement. Homeowners in Amherst can expect heating and cooling cost reductions of 15 to 30 percent following proper insulation upgrades, with some homes achieving even greater savings depending on their starting conditions. These savings accumulate year after year, often allowing insulation improvements to pay for themselves within three to five years through reduced utility bills alone.

Beyond direct energy savings, proper attic insulation provides numerous additional benefits that enhance your home’s value and livability.

  • Consistent room temperatures: Eliminates cold spots in winter and hot zones in summer
  • Reduced HVAC strain: Systems cycle less frequently, extending equipment lifespan
  • Noise reduction: Additional insulation dampens outside noise transmission
  • Improved indoor air quality: Proper sealing reduces outdoor pollutant infiltration
  • Enhanced resale value: Energy-efficient homes command premium prices in today’s market

Regular attic inspections help maintain insulation effectiveness over time. We recommend checking attic insulation annually for signs of settling, moisture damage, or pest activity. Ice dams forming along roof edges often indicate inadequate attic insulation or ventilation problems requiring professional attention.
